§70-2271. Example for other agencies.

The leadership in developing arrangements for understanding and cooperative action between these two agencies of state government, the State Board of Career and Technology Education and the Oklahoma State Regents for Higher Education, should be an example for other agencies of state government for cooperation and teamwork when responsibilities of a common nature fall within the bounds of their respective jurisdictions; and the Legislature, by this expression, commends this display of cooperation by these two boards as example for the challenge and guidance of other agencies of state government accordingly.
Added by Laws 1973, p. 553, S.J.R. No. 35, § 21. Amended by Laws 2001, c. 33, § 141, eff. July 1, 2001.
